Commercial Mulching in Honolulu, HI
Commercial mulching services involve spreading a layer of mulch around landscaped areas, garden beds, and planting zones to improve the appearance and health of outdoor spaces. This service is often requested for various projects, including commercial properties, parks, and large residential landscapes, where maintaining a tidy, attractive, and well-protected environment is a priority. Property owners typically seek information about the types of mulch available, such as wood, bark, or rubber, and want to understand how mulching can help with weed control, moisture retention, and soil temperature regulation.
Before requesting mulching services, property owners usually want to clarify the scope of the project, including the size of the area to be covered and any specific landscape features or plantings involved. It’s also helpful to consider the type of mulch that best suits the landscape’s needs and aesthetic preferences, as well as any existing landscaping or drainage considerations. Proper preparation, such as clearing debris or existing mulch, may be necessary to ensure the best results for the mulching process.

Commercial Mulching Questions
What is commercial mulching? Commercial mulching involves applying a layer of mulch to large landscape areas to improve appearance and health.
What types of projects benefit from mulching? Mulching is ideal for large commercial properties, parks, and landscaping beds needing weed control and moisture retention.
How does mulching improve property landscapes? Mulching helps suppress weeds, retain soil moisture, and provide a neat, finished look to landscaped areas.
What materials are used for commercial mulching? Common mulch materials include wood chips, bark, rubber, and compost, depending on project needs.
